Note: Recorded programmes are saved into the
connected USB disk. If desired, you can store/copy
recordings onto a computer; however, these files will
not be available to be played on a computer. You can
play the recordings only via your TV.
Note: Lip Sync delay may occur during the timeshifting.
Radio record is supported. The TV can record
programmes up to ten hours.
Recorded programmes are split into 4GB partitions.
If the writing speed of the connected USB disk is not
sufficient, the recording may fail and the timeshifting
feature may not be available.
It is recommended to use USB hard disk drives for
recording HD programmes.
Do not plug out the USB/HDD during a recording.
This may harm the connected USB/HDD.
Multipartition support is available. The maximum
of two different partitions are supported. The first
partition of the USB disk is used for PVR ready
features. It also must be formatted as the primary
partition to be used for the PVR ready features.
Some stream packets may not be recorded
because of signal problems, so sometimes video
may freezes during playback.
Record, Play, Pause, Display (for PlayListDialog)
keys can not be used when teletext is ON. If a
recording starts from timer when teletext is ON,
teletext is automatically turned off. Also teletext
usage is disabled when there is an ongoing
recording or playback.
Timeshift Recording
Press
(PAUSE) button while watching a
broadcast to activate timeshifting mode.In
timeshifting mode, the programme is paused and
simultaneously recorded to the connected USB
disk. Press
(PLAY) button again to resume the
paused programme from where you stopped.
Press the STOP button to stop timeshift recording
and return to the live broadcast.
Note: Timeshift cannot be used while in radio mode.
Note : You cannot use the timeshift fast reverse
feature before advancing the playback with the fast
forward option.

Watching Recorded Programmes
Select the Recordings Library from the Media
Browser menu. Select a recorded item from the
list (if previously recorded). Press the OK button
to view the Play Options. Select an option then
press OK button.
Note: Viewing main menu and menu items will not be
available during the playback.
Press the
(STOP) button to stop a playback and
return to the Recordings Library.

Recording Configuration
Select the Recording Configuration item in the
Settings menu to configure the recording settings.
Format Disk: You can use Format Disk feature
for formatting the connected USB disk. Your pin
is required to use the Format Disk feature (default
pin is 0000).
IMPORTANT: Note that ALL the data stored on
the USB disk will be lost and the disk format
will be converted to FAT32 if you activate this
feature. If your USB disk malfunctions, you can try
formatting the USB disk. In most cases formatting
the USB disk will restore normal operation;
however, ALL the data stored on the USB disk
will be lost in such a case.
Note: If "USB is too slow" message is displayed on the screen
while starting a recording, try restarting the recording. If you
still get the same error, it is possible that your USB disk does
not meet the USB 2.0 speed requirements. Try connecting
another USB disk.
